MARION — Public and private stakeholders are ready to turn the page on the former Marion public library site with the proposal of a new multiuse building in Uptown Marion.

Developers on Thursday presented plans for an estimated $21 million, mixed-use building at the former library site on Sixth Avenue across from City Square Park. The yet-named development would include roughly 12,000 square feet of first-floor commercial space and 63 upper-level apartments.

While still early in the stages, Kilbourne Group President and Developer Mike Allmendinger said the goal is to foster a unique identity for the project while still complementing the surrounding Uptown district.
